Synthesis (Verdict & Resolution)

Mannatech's latest 8-K confirms a leadership change in the finance department, replacing the outgoing CFO with a former internal controller. While the company presents this as a step toward institutionalizing financial rigor, the brevity of the previous CFO's tenure creates a narrative of instability. The market's reaction will likely depend on whether Haider can quickly translate his M&A and capital planning expertise into tangible balance sheet improvements.

10-QMay 14, 2026
Expand Sequence

Mannatech's Q1 2026 filing presents a stark contrast between improving internal efficiency and deteriorating external demand. On one hand, management has successfully executed a 'lean' mandate, reducing operating expenses and improving gross margins. On the other, the core business is shrinking, particularly in the critical North American market, and the company is fighting a battle against Nasdaq delisting and high-cost debt. The central tension for investors is whether the cost-cutting measures and ERP system fixes can outpace the decline in the associate network. The shift to positive operating cash flow is a positive signal, but the reliance on foreign exchange gains to reach net profitability suggests the turnaround is not yet self-sustaining. The coming quarters will be a critical test of whether the company can stabilize its associate base while maintaining its new, lower cost structure.
